Welcome to on-call for the Glimmerpane design system! Our snapshot tests live in the `snapcheck` suite and run on every merge to main. If a UI component changes visually, the diff bot flags it — usually it's an intentional tweak, so just approve the new baseline. If it's 2am and snapshots are failing across the board, it's almost always a font-loading race, not your problem. To unlock the baseline store and re-approve snapshots in bulk, use the recovery passphrase below.

recovery phrase for tahag-taguf: wenix-caswyn

Subject: Thumbnail queue cut-over complete

The migration of the Grindlepress thumbnail generation queue from the legacy poller to the new Corvid broker finished at 03:40 with no dropped jobs. Backlog drained within twenty minutes. Retry semantics changed: failed renders now dead-letter after four attempts instead of looping. Please review the diff against these notes. The queue is now running with the following configuration.

config for kawif-hahig:
zorix:
  log_level: error
  metrics_host: metrics.zorix.lumiclabs.internal
  pool_size: 16

Q3 Planning Note — Finance Team

Quick update on the Marlowe's Pantry pilot. We're rolling our Shelfwise trial into twelve of their stores across the Carden Valley region starting mid-quarter. Expect setup costs to land in October, with the first usage invoices following about six weeks later. Margins look thin at first but improve once we hit store fifteen. Keep the accrual flexible — terms may shift. Before booking anything, read the note below.

management briefing: Project Ulavan slips by two quarters because of the staffing delay.